To Myself
Photo by Rita Morais on Unsplash

My vision,

to play happily on the rocks.

Let the wind play with

my senses.

******

The waves

and wind beckoned

my soul

to revel in the moment.

******

Not all calls,

should be answered.

Some are negative

some are good.

******

The risk one takes

in the name of fun

doesn’t aways

work in the way you intend.

******

a sudden shift

horrible shoes

led to a fall

and damage was done.

******

Now I am mad

at me.

One thoughtless deed

is compromising my goal.

******

One week?

Two weeks?

How long will I pay

for this irresponsible deed?

******

How many treats

can I not give my friends

because of

my nuthatch play?

******

I am so angry

with the

irresponsible decision

that I chose to do.

******

The only thing

I can do

is trust

that there is magic.

******

That all will be

okay,

an happy trip,

and happy friends.
